Blogging goes bigtime at Sundance - and gains the attention of Yahoo and AOL while taking on the big boys: Los Angeles Times and the New York Times.

Blogging has now permeated every part of American culture. From the news (political bloggers) to the arts (movie goers) it’s undeniable that blogging is serious business.

“As blogs become more successful, they are challenging traditional media, and this year’s Sundance marks a fascinating juncture as newly powerful blogs like Cinematical.com take on the likes of the Los Angeles Times and the New York Times.”

Reuters/Hollywood Reporter

Hollywood has just discovered how to put word-of-mouth marketing for movies - on steroids - with blogging! They know their buzz will be louder than ever as they have top bloggers in their industry giving movie goers all over the world the scoop - real time - and faster than traditional main stream media can even try and compete with.

The originial genius behind the idea of bringing blogs into the cinematic world was Jason Calacanis, founder of Weblogs Inc. who persuaded the festival to let him blog about the festival, and the movies he viewed, giving his readers LIVE coverage - from inside the movie theatre.

Now THAT’S instant buzz!
And for those of you business bloggers wondering what the arts have to do with the business of blogging, and marketing with business blogs - check out these cool facts for yourself:

  • 2005 was the year Weblogs morphed BloggingSundance into Cinematical.com, a community blog for movie fans and gets over 50,000 hits a day - and is increasing in numbers every day.
  • Enter - the big boys… (if you still need convincing that blogging is indeed serious business) AOL bought Weblogs and its 80 blogs in October, 2005 for a reported $25 million!
